Beyond the translation

Overall song meaning

The song is a playful, romantic track from the movie 'February 14' (2005) celebrating contemporary young love. The lovers dismiss historic tragic romances like Laila-Majnu and Romeo-Juliet as myths compared to the real, vibrant affection they share. They describe how love consumes their individual identities, making them lose themselves in each other through playful banter, poetic hyperboles, and contrasting imagery like Buddha's peace versus Hitler's fire.

Writing craft

Poetic devices

Antithesis / Contrast (Eturoidai)

Laila majunu poi thaan ... Naanum neeyum mei thaan

Contrasting historical tragedy and peace/destruction with present reality (poi vs mei; Buddha's flower vs Hitler's fire).

Simile (Uvamai)

Azhagana poonai pola madiyin meedu sarigindraai

Comparing the lover to a cute cat sliding onto the lap, and comparing the light to a lure consuming a moth.

Metaphor (Uruvagama)

Idhu sugama valikum kaayam

Comparing love's pain to a sweet, pleasant wound (sugama valikum kaayam).

Wordplay / Pun (Sleidai)

Nee boogambama illai poo-kambamma

Playing on the terms 'boogambam' (earthquake) and 'poo-kambam' (flower sparkler).

Did you know?

Trivia

The film 'February 14' stars Bharath and Renuka Menon. The music was composed by Bhardwaj, and the lyrics were penned by Na. Muthukumar, showcasing his signature youthful and witty lyrical style.
